CLIENT RELATIONS

This program provides students with exposure to strategies and techniques that will help them to solidify and enhance their client relations skills and build positive, lasting relationships with clients. The program prepares graduates to build teams of staff dedicated to excellent service delivery, identify, mitigate ands avoid confrontational situations with internal and external clients and to create and promote an organizational service culture.


The program is directly applicable to employment in all industries. Graduates can secure employment directly in the service sector (retail, hospitality, contact centre, business office, etc.).
